#2c6633 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c6633 is composed of 17.3% red, 40%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 127.2 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 28.6%. #2c6633 color hex could be obtained by blending #58cc66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#2c6633 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#2c6633 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c6633 has RGB values of R:44, G:102,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2909747.

Shades and Tints of #2c6633
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030603 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c6633
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484a48 is the less saturated color, while #058d15 is the most saturated one.
